How much do staff failure analysis eng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for staff failure analysis engineer in the United States is $99,330.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$69,000.00 and $125,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a Staff Failure Analysis Engineer typically collaborate with other departments to resolve product issues?

As a Staff Failure Analysis Engineer, you will frequently work cross-functionally with design, manufacturing, quality, and reliability engineering teams. Your insights from root-cause investigations are essential for guiding corrective actions and informing design improvements. Effective communication and documentation are key, as you'll often present findings in meetings and generate detailed reports for both technical and non-technical stakeholders. This collaborative environment ensures that product issues are addressed efficiently and future failures are minimized.

What are Staff Failure Analysis Engineers?

Staff Failure Analysis Engineers are specialized professionals who investigate and determine the root causes of product or component failures in manufacturing and engineering environments. They use advanced analytical techniques and tools to identify defects or weaknesses in materials, components, or processes. Their insights help companies improve product reliability, prevent future failures, and support quality assurance. These engineers often work closely with design, manufacturing, and quality teams to implement corrective actions and enhance product performance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Staff Failure Analysis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Staff Failure Analysis Engineer, you need a solid background in electrical engineering, materials science, or a related field, with expertise in root-cause analysis and semiconductor device physics. Familiarity with analytical tools such as SEM, TEM, FIB, and failure analysis software, as well as industry-standard certifications like IPC or Six Sigma, is often required. Strong problem-solving,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you collaborate with cross-functional teams and clearly report findings. These skills and qualifications are crucial for diagnosing product failures, improving reliability, and supporting product development cycles.

THE ROLE
Join a highly visible engineering team responsible for bringing up, debugging, and improving next-generation server and rack-scale platforms deployed in data center environments. As a Senior Failure Analysis Engineer, you will be among the first engineers to investigate, troubleshoot, and resolve complex system-level issues on new hardware platforms, partnering closely with design, firmware, validation, manufacturing, quality, and infrastructure teams. This role offers the opportunity to work on cutting-edge technologies while driving root cause analysis, platform reliability, and manufacturing readiness across the product lifecycle. You will play a key role in identifying and resolving complex hardware and firmware interactions, supporting platform bring-up activities, improving debug processes, and helping scale organizational knowledge through technical documentation and AI-assisted engineering workflows. This is an ideal opportunity for an engineer who enjoys solving difficult technical problems, working across multiple disciplines, and making a measurable impact on the success of next-generation data center products.
THE PERSON
The ideal candidate is naturally curious, analytical, and motivated by solving complex technical challenges. They thrive in environments where not every answer is immediately available and are comfortable investigating issues across multiple engineering domains to identify root causes and drive resolution. They demonstrate strong communication skills, effectively manage stakeholder expectations during ongoing investigations, and can clearly communicate technical findings to both engineering and cross-functional teams.
Successful candidates are collaborative, adaptable, and persistent problem-solvers who enjoy learning new technologies, working in highly dynamic environments, and continuously improving how engineering teams operate. They embrace new tools and technologies, including AI-assisted workflows, to improve efficiency, accelerate troubleshooting, and scale technical knowledge across the organization.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Perform system-level and rack-level failure analysis across server and data center platforms, driving issues from initial symptom identification through root cause determination and resolution.
  • Debug complex hardware, firmware, and platform-related issues involving CPUs, GPUs, memory, PCIe, networking, power delivery, thermal systems, and firmware interactions.
  • Analyze system logs, platform telemetry, BIOS, BMC, and other diagnostic data to identify failure patterns, isolate root causes, and validate corrective actions.
  • Reproduce failures in lab environments and utilize appropriate diagnostic tools and methodologies to validate fixes and improve overall platform reliability.
  • Partner closely with design, firmware, validation, manufacturing, quality, and infrastructure teams to investigate issues, drive corrective actions, and improve system performance.
  • Support manufacturing and ODM partners by providing technical guidance, failure triage, structured debug processes, and escalation support for complex platform issues.
  • Develop and maintain technical documentation, troubleshooting guides, SOPs, debug methodologies, and knowledge-sharing resources to improve organizational effectiveness.
  • Drive root cause analysis activities and contribute to continuous improvements in reliability, serviceability, manufacturability, and operational readiness.
  • Leverage AI-assisted tools, automation, and knowledge systems to improve troubleshooting efficiency, accelerate investigations, and scale engineering best practices.
  • Serve as a technical resource for cross-functional teams by communicating findings, managing stakeholder expectations, and providing clear recommendations based on data-driven analysis.
  • Contribute expertise in areas such as networking, signal integrity, system architecture, or platform reliability to support the successful deployment of next-generation data center technologies.
